Professor Copeland to Rend Tonight

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Tonight at 8.30 in the Dining Room of the Union, Professor C. T. Copeland'82, of the English Department, will read selections from Dickens and Kipling to members of the Graduate School of Education and their guests. He will precede his reading by a brief address on "Dickens' Beat Book,"
